What is Oregano?
Oregano is a flowering plant in the mint family. The name oregano comes from the Greek words “Oreos” and “ganos” which mean “mountain joy”. The herb is native to Mediterranean and Southern Asian regions but has now spread to other parts of the world, including the temperate climate areas of America. It is grown as a culinary herb and also as a source of essential oil. The leaves of the herb are generally dark green, with a pungent aroma and a bitter taste.
The herb is commonly used in Italian, Mexican, and Mediterranean cuisines. It can be used as a garnish on pizza, sandwiches, and sauces, and in soups and stews.

Oregano for digestion
One of the most widely known oregano health benefits is its ability to improve digestion. The herb has carminative properties, which help aid in eliminating gas and reducing indigestion. It is also a rich source of essential oils and phenolic compounds that stimulate the secretion of digestive enzymes. These enzymes aid in the healthy digestion of foods and help you break down the nutrients from your diet.
